About Chickamauga Lake

Chickamauga Lake is a fabulous recreational reservoir located in southeast Tennessee, 20 miles from Chattanooga. It is used for recreation, but was originally developed for flood protection and power generation. The name Chickamaugas is derived from the name of the warlike tribe that split from the Cherokee tribe and founded its main village in the area.
